Description: Loudoun County's Office of Solid Waste Management announces the Household Hazardous Waste collection event schedule for 2008. There will be eight collection events this year. All events are on a Saturday, from 8:30 a.m. to 2:30 p.m., and are for county residents only.
Typical HHW items are oil-based paints/stains/varnishes, paint thinners, old fuels including gas/oil mixes, kerosene, and diesel fuel; and cleaners such as oven cleaners, drain cleaners, bathroom cleaners, and all purpose cleaners. Other HHW items are scouring powders, mothballs, mildew removers, metal polishes, rust removers, wood preservatives, pet care products, furniture polishes and waxes, pool chemicals and most automotive maintenance products.
The first step to identifying HHW is to read the label and watch for the following warning words: Caution, Warning, Danger, Poison, Toxic, Flammable, Combustible, Explosive, Volatile or Corrosive. There may be handling warnings such as "Avoid Contact with Skin or Eyes," "Keep Away from Children" or "Strong Oxidizer."
Remember, used motor oil, used automobile or lead-acid batteries and used antifreeze can be recycled year round for free at the Loudoun County Solid Waste Management Facility at 20939 Evergreen Mills Road, Monday through Saturday, from 8:00 a.m. to 4:00 p.m. They will not be accepted at HHW collection events. Propane tanks also are accepted at the landfill but not at HHW collection events.
Computers and other electronics are not accepted at the HHW events. Loudoun County will host two electronics collection events this year. More information about electronics recycling is available at www.loudoun.gov/electronics .
Also, latex and water-based paints are not a hazardous waste. Dry or solidify leftover paint for disposal with your household garbage.
